Transaction 0663ca5edb6821953aa25db2fc3aa43b6eece8bfef03d78eb3000a8380ce196b
2 Input
2 Outputs
- 0663ca5edb6821953aa25db2fc3aa43b6eece8bfef03d78eb3000a8380ce196b:0
- 0663ca5edb6821953aa25db2fc3aa43b6eece8bfef03d78eb3000a8380ce196b:1
value 5416642
address 367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
value 1350000
address 36m2fr1Rj15SfViMqV7RaiRkwyEY6s7N5S